In January of 2024, Encorus Group merged with Sienna Environmental Technologies. With this merger, the Regulated Building Materials (RBM) division was formed at Encorus, integrating Sienna’s expertise within Encorus Group. With this new division, Encorus can now perform a wide range of services associated with environmental, hazardous, and regulated building materials management and abatement. RBM division service offerings include hazardous building materials inspections, abatement design, contract oversight, project monitoring, and air quality sampling for renovation and demolition projects. As Sienna Environmental Technologies, our RBM division served more than 400 public and private clients throughout the Northeast, many in ongoing relationships.  The RBM division has been a partner to architectural and engineering design firms, construction companies, colleges and universities, K-12 schools, and local, state and federal government agencies including DASNY, NYS OGS, SUCF, NYPA, and USACE.
